#231c82 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#231c82 is composed of 13.7% red, 11%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.1%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 244.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 31%. #231c82 color hex could be obtained by blending #4638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#231c82 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#231c82 has RGB values of R:35, G:28,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2301058.

Shades and Tints of #231c82
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1f0fc is the lightest one.
